Guidelines for Attaining a Flawless Result
Achieving a impeccable finish in autostar panel paint jobs demands detailed planning. Commence by thoroughly washing the area of the panel to get rid of any grime, oil, or previous paint leftovers. Use a premium primer that is suitable with the autostar paint to enhance sticking and create a level base. Sanding down the area lightly before putting on the primer can improve the adhesion, ensuring that the final coat is even.
Once the primer has set, it is essential to put on the autostar paint in a controlled environment. Ultimately, work in a breezy area, clear from debris and contamination. Apply the paint in delicate, consistent coats, allowing each layer to dry completely before adding another. Maintaining a consistent distance from the panel while spraying helps avoid drips and drips, contributing to a professional-looking finish.
Finalizing the job involves using a top coat to shield the paint and boost its luster. Once the final layer of hue has set, lightly sand the panel lightly with a smooth sandpaper to get rid of any imperfections. Follow up with a clear coat application, and for more depth, consider polishing the surface after it completely dries. This step-by-step approach makes sure that the end result does not only looks amazing but also withstands to the test of time.
Frequent Errors to Steer Clear in Autostar Panel Painting
A common mistake in autostar panel painting is insufficient surface preparation. Numerous individuals neglect to thoroughly clean and sand the panels before applying the paint. This oversight can lead to poor adhesion, resulting in peeling or flaking over time. To achieve a superior finish, it is essential to remove any grease, dirt, or previous paint and to create a level surface that allows the new paint to bond properly.
A further frequent error is applying the wrong type of paint or not following properly advised application methods. Not all paints are suitable for autostar panel applications, and choosing a low-quality option can reduce the overall appearance and longevity of the finish. Additionally, applying paint too heavily or too quickly can create drips and uneven textures. It is crucial to select high-quality, compatible paints and to follow proper spraying techniques for uniform coats and a professional look.
Finally, neglecting environmental conditions during the painting process is a common mistake that can affect the results. Factors such as temperature, humidity, and ventilation play a critical role in how the paint dries and adheres. Painting in extreme conditions can lead to issues like bubbling or improper curing. Always check the weather and ensure a well-ventilated work area before commencing the panel painting to avoid these pitfalls and achieve the optimal possible outcome.
